Hyphen and AAWW Short Story Contest DEADLINE EXTENDED!!!
Great news for you undiscovered fiction writers out there: the Hyphen and Asian American Writers' Workshop Short Story contest deadline has been extended to Monday Sept. 29th, 2008. So, dust off that typewriter and polish up that story from that writing workshop in college ... you have a few more months to let the creativity flow.
Stories will be judged by Preeta Samarasan - winner of the 2007 Hyphen and AAWW Short Story competition and author of the new novel "Evening is the Whole Day" (Houghton Mifflin) - and Monica Ferrell, author of "The Answer is Always Yes."
